Abstract
An illuminating device 1 for illuminating signs 2 provided on the sides of vehicles 4 having elevated sides comprises an elongate waterproof housing having one or more LEDs. The sign may in particular be a vehicle livery applied to the side of a truck. A side light baffle may be provided which acts to baffle the illumination to the front or rear of the vehicle to limit seepage of light in these directions. The light source is preferably elongate and provided with means to change the angle of illumination and this adjustment may be made manually or electrically. A light sensor, movement sensor and/or timer means may be provided to control activation of the illumination.

AN ILLUMINATING VEHICLE LIVERY APPARATUS
Field of the Invention
The present invention relates to illuminating vehicle livery apparatus, in particular apparatus for displaying illuminated signage, for example on high sided vehicles.
Background
Increasing amounts of trade in many societies is conducted on-line or at a distance between customer and supplier.
In addition, or the alternative, it can be important to many businesses to have a realworld visibility.
As a consequence greater numbers of deliveries are occurring across many societies and greater numbers of delivery vehicles may be seen across road networks of many 1 areas.

Prior Art
CN 202 911 613 (ZHANG) discloses a moving advertising vehicle (with a lightemitting diode (LED) display and a stage), and a vehicle on the land used as an advertising device. The moving advertising vehicle comprises a vehicle body, a compartment, a chassis, a visible transparent advertising display window and a foldable stage. The foldable stage is connected with the vehicle body through a hydraulic controller, the LED display is arranged on at least one lateral side of the compartment, and the LED display is connected with a controller arranged on the lower portion of one side of the vehicle. The display window is arranged on the other lateral side of the compartment, a box door of the display window is transparent and can be opened from one side, an advertising lamp box plate is arranged in the box boor of the display window, and alternating rolling advertising of advertisement can be conducted by using a roller. A rear door can be opened downwards, and a hinge is arranged on the lower portion. A lower box opening door is arranged on the lower portion of the rear side, and a pedal is arranged in the lower box opening door.
Loudspeakers of a playing control system are arranged at the front end and the rear end of the compartment, and the loudspeaker at the front end can rotate.
US 8 938 897 (BORREGGINE et al) discloses in combination with a highway tractor of the type having an operator's cab mounted on a frame, a vertical pivotal coupling means coupled to the frame behind the cab adapted to be coupled to a trailer, and an aerodynamic structure at the top of the cab which includes a plurality of LED bulbs and a heat generating element in the front of the aerodynamic structure. A front panel of glass or plastic material having information such as a logo containing letters and/or images located on its first surface, second surface or embedded surface covers the
LED bulbs with a weatherproof seal. Light from the LED bulbs provides illumination for the information on the front panel to be viewed from the front of the highway tractor and heat from the heat generating element helps to keep the front panel 1 having information such as a logo free of snow and/or ice.

Summary of the Invention
According to the present invention there is provided an illuminating vehicle livery apparatus for use with a vehicle with elevated sides, signage being arranged on at least one of said sides, and at least one light source device arranged adjacent the signage, so as to illuminate said signage; characterised in that the illuminating vehicle livery apparatus has at least one light source device comprises an elongate waterproof housing, one or more light emitting diodes and the signage has a side light baffle, which acts to baffle the illumination or light source from the front or rear of the vehicle, to limit seepage of light contrary to safety regulations.
In some embodiments the waterproof housing is permanently attached to a side of the vehicle using a permanent attachment means. In other embodiments the attachment means may be temporary, so as to allow use of plural vehicles. In some embodiments the attachment means may comprise ferromagnetic attachment means. In some embodiments it may be envisaged that at least two of such housings are envisaged to be present in the apparatus at any one time.
In some embodiments the housing comprises or is attached to a shield or cover over the light source, wherein the light source is shielded from ingress of moisture from above and has no or transparent or translucent shielding below, and may be arranged such that the light source is arranged to illuminate downwards without obstruction. The light source may comprise one or more light emitting diode (LED). For example the light source may comprise plural LEDs arranged in a line within the housing. The light source may comprise one or more reflectors.
The apparatus may comprise a dedicated energy source. For example the apparatus may comprise at least one battery associated with a light source, for example contained within the housing.
In some embodiments the energy source may comprise the vehicle battery, for example wherein setup of the apparatus includes securing the apparatus wires to the vehicle’s electrical supply, for example the battery though the lighting system.
In other embodiments the energy source may be comprised in an energy harvesting means, for example at least one solar photovoltaic cell. The, or each, housing may alternatively comprise air flow power harvesting means, so that electricity is generated due to a wind turbine.
In some embodiments the apparatus comprises an activation means, which activation means is arranged to activate or deactivate the light source device or light source devices, individually or contemporaneously.
In some embodiments the activation means comprises a light sensor so as to switch on the device at a desired level of ambient light. Likewise the sensor may be used to switch off the device at a specific light level.
In some embodiments the activation means comprises a movement sensor so as to switch on a display when a passing person is detected.

In the pictured embodiment the light source device 1 comprises a monolithic unit which can be attached to a delivery vehicle to illuminate advertisements on a large variety of vehicles, and may be available in a range of colours and lengths.
The pictured embodiment is correspondingly simple to mount to the vehicle 4 and utilises the vehicle battery (not shown) as a power source.
The housing 21 may be mounted in any orientation whether lighting is required from above or below the signage 2 or advertisement.
The light source device comprises a plurality of light emitting diodes (LEDs) 10, 5 which are spaced apart and arranged in an elongate manner along a planar lighting platform 19 arranged longitudinally in the housing 21.
The platform 18 is arranged on pivoting pins 17 fastened in caps 12 closing either end of the housing 21 so as to allow redirection of the platform’s LEDs with reference to a horizontal axis A.
In the pictured embodiment a pivoting pin sprung plunger 19 allows the platform to twist and then lock in place once a handle is released.
The housing 21 comprises sheet metal casing describing an upside down tray substantially closed by plates 20 to each end and above by a hood 32, with end rubber gaskets 16 creating a seal to prevent water from entering the housing 21.

The cover comprises a D shape in section, wherein a top comprises a cover 31 for the hood, and a bottom-most lip 15 clipping under the housing rear bar 23.
The compression spring plunger 19 alters the platform 18 angle and then locks into place once released, comprising a spring biased index plunger changing the angle of the platform 18 by the user pulling, twisting and releasing the plunger handle such that a pin locates in a hole to fix the platform 18 in place.
The plunger 19 and pin 17 locate into perforations 22 in the end plates 20, which perforations further enable ventilation to the LEDs.
In some embodiments the plunger 19 may be operable mechanically from a lower location, for example using an elongate handle.
In some embodiments the platform angle may be manipulated by an electrically driven mechanism, such as a plunger, worm screw or hydraulic arm.
In this way the user may alter the lighting of the signage as required. For example in some embodiments the angle may be altered automatically, whereby an accelerometer may register changes in velocity of the vehicle and alter the angle to increase lighting
